Before you start designing shirts and setting up your website, it’s important to do your due diligence by researching the market and analyzing your competition. This will give you insight into who your target audience is, what type of products they’re looking for, and what strategies your competitors are using.

Identifying Your Target Audience

The first step is to identify your target audience. Think about who you’re designing for and what type of shirts they would be interested in. You should also consider their age, location, interests, and lifestyle. Once you have a clearer picture of your ideal customer, you can tailor your designs and marketing efforts accordingly.

Analyzing Competitors

You should also spend time researching your competitors. Take a look at their websites, social media accounts, and product offerings. Take note of what they’re doing right and wrong so you can learn from their successes and mistakes. Additionally, you can use tools like Google Trends to see which types of shirts are trending in your industry.

Understanding Industry Trends

It’s also important to stay up to date on the latest industry trends. Keep an eye out for new technologies, fabrics, and printing techniques that could give you an edge over the competition. Additionally, you should pay attention to any changes in consumer preferences or buying habits that could affect your business.

In order to stand out from the crowd, you’ll want to create a unique selling proposition (USP). This is a statement that describes what makes your business different and why customers should choose you over your competitors. Consider factors such as quality, price, selection, convenience, and customer service when crafting your USP.

Differentiating Your Brand

Your USP should focus on what sets your brand apart from other online shirt businesses. Think about what unique features you offer and how you can emphasize them in your marketing materials. You should also strive to create a cohesive brand identity across all your platforms, from web design to logo design.

Leveraging What Makes You Stand Out

Once you’ve identified what makes your business unique, you can leverage it to attract more customers. For example, if you specialize in organic cotton shirts, you can highlight that fact in your advertisements and on your website. You can also create blog posts and videos that showcase the benefits of your products.

After you’ve established your brand, it’s time to start designing your shirts. Consider the type of fabric you’ll use, the colors and patterns you’ll incorporate, and the type of printing technique you’ll employ. All of these factors will help determine the overall look and feel of your shirts.

Choosing the Right Fabrics

When it comes to choosing fabrics for your shirts, you’ll want to consider both quality and cost. Look for fabrics that are durable, comfortable, and easy to care for. You may also want to experiment with different fabrics to see which ones your customers prefer.

Exploring Printing Techniques

Next, you’ll need to decide which printing technique you’ll use. Options include screen printing, direct-to-garment printing, embroidery, and heat transfer. Each method has its own pros and cons, so do your research before making a decision. You should also factor in the cost of printing supplies when calculating your costs.

Utilizing Professional Design Services

If you don’t have experience designing shirts, you may want to hire a professional designer. Look for someone with experience in the apparel industry who can help you create a product that’s both fashionable and functional. If you’re on a tight budget, you can also look for freelance designers who offer competitive rates.

Invest in a Quality eCommerce Platform

Once you’ve designed your shirts and chosen your printing methods, it’s time to invest in a quality eCommerce platform. This will enable you to set up an online store and start selling your products. There are many options out there, so it’s important to do your research and find one that meets your needs.

Evaluating Features and Benefits

When selecting an eCommerce platform, take a look at the features and benefits each one offers. Consider factors such as ease of use, customization options, payment processing solutions, and customer support. You’ll also want to make sure the platform integrates seamlessly with your other systems and services.

Investigating Payment Processing Solutions

Another important consideration is the payment processing solution the platform offers. Make sure the processor you choose is secure and reliable. You should also look for one that supports multiple payment methods, including credit cards, PayPal, and Apple Pay.

Finding Ways to Keep Customers Coming Back

Finally, you’ll want to look for ways to keep customers coming back. Offer discounts, loyalty programs, and special promotions to reward repeat customers. You should also consider adding additional features to your website, such as a blog or forum, to keep customers engaged.
